Lenovo has announced a new mobile broadband plan for buyers of its ThinkPad notebook computers that don’t want a contract and may only want access to mobile broadband here and there. The new plan is called Lenovo Mobile Access and offers several different packages to meet different needs for mobile broadband away from Wi-Fi networks.
Flexible Short-Term Plans
The service will offer an option of only 30 minutes of access for $1.95. This is ideal for users who need to quickly check emails, download a document, or perform other brief online tasks without committing to a longer plan. For those who need more extended access, people wanting a full day of access will pay $8.95. This daily plan is perfect for business travelers or anyone who needs reliable internet access for a day without worrying about finding Wi-Fi hotspots.
There is no indication of data caps on either of those plans, which means users can enjoy uninterrupted service without the fear of hitting a data limit. This flexibility makes Lenovo Mobile Access a convenient option for users with varying internet needs.
Monthly Plans for Regular Users
People needing access on an ongoing basis will be able to sign up for a no-contract monthly plan. Lenovo hasn’t announced pricing on the monthly plans, but one will offer 2 GB of data and another will offer 6 GB of data. These plans cater to users who require consistent internet access for activities such as streaming, video conferencing, or extensive browsing.
Presumably, the pricing would be somewhere in the $30 monthly range, making it a competitive option compared to traditional mobile broadband plans that often require long-term contracts. The no-contract nature of these plans provides users with the freedom to cancel or change their plan as their needs evolve, without incurring penalties or fees.
The service will be ready to go on any Lenovo notebook purchased with a mobile broadband modem inside. This means that users can start using Lenovo Mobile Access immediately upon receiving their device, without the need for additional hardware or complicated setup processes.
